TLV2322IPE4 Overview

Operational Amplifiers - Op Amps Dual Lo-Voltage uPwr Op Amp

TLV2322IPE4 Parametric

Parameter NameAttribute value
Is it lead-free?Lead free
Is it Rohs certified?conform to
Parts packaging codeDIP
package instructionPLASTIC, DIP-8
Contacts8
Reach Compliance Codeunknown
ECCN codeEAR99
Amplifier typeOPERATIONAL AMPLIFIER
ArchitectureVOLTAGE-FEEDBACK
Maximum average bias current (IIB)0.002 µA
Minimum Common Mode Rejection Ratio60 dB
Nominal Common Mode Rejection Ratio88 dB
frequency compensationYES
Maximum input offset voltage11000 µV
JESD-30 codeR-PDIP-T8
JESD-609 codee4
length9.81 mm
low-biasYES
low-dissonanceNO
micropowerYES
Number of functions2
Number of terminals8
Maximum operating temperature85 °C
Minimum operating temperature-40 °C
Package body materialPLASTIC/EPOXY
encapsulated codeDIP
Encapsulate equivalent codeDIP8,.3
Package shapeRECTANGULAR
Package formIN-LINE
method of packingTUBE
Peak Reflow Temperature (Celsius)NOT SPECIFIED
power supply2/8 V
Certification statusNot Qualified
Maximum seat height5.08 mm
Nominal slew rate0.02 V/us
Maximum slew rate0.054 mA
Supply voltage upper limit8 V
Nominal supply voltage (Vsup)3 V
surface mountNO
technologyCMOS
Temperature levelINDUSTRIAL
Terminal surfaceNickel/Palladium/Gold (Ni/Pd/Au)
Terminal formTHROUGH-HOLE
Terminal pitch2.54 mm
Terminal locationDUAL
Maximum time at peak reflow temperatureNOT SPECIFIED
Nominal Uniform Gain Bandwidth27 kHz
Minimum voltage gain50000
width7.62 mm
Base Number Matches1
